Wrong-Way BMW Driver Caused Fatal Santa Ana Crash, Killing Two

- π₯ Two individuals, identified as the drivers of their respective vehicles, were killed in a high-speed, wrong-way crash in Santa Ana.
- π Police believe the driver of a BMW, identified as 29-year-old Ensue, was heading the wrong way on Main Street at speeds close to 90 mph in a 45 mph zone.
- π Ensue slammed into another vehicle, resulting in the death of the other driver and himself.
Chain Reaction and Injuries
- π₯ The initial collision triggered a fiery chain reaction involving three other vehicles.
- π¨βπ©βπ§βπ¦ An innocent family of five traveling in one of the affected vehicles was transported to a local hospital with non-life-threatening injuries.
- π Neighbors attempted to help extract victims from the wreckage, but it was too late for those involved in the initial impact.
Investigation and Intent
- β οΈ Authorities do not believe the crash was accidental, suggesting the BMW driver's actions may have been intentional due to the extreme speed.
- β Factors contributing to the crash, including whether the driver's actions were intentional, are being investigated, though the driver is deceased.
- ποΈ White crosses now stand as a memorial at the crash site for both victims.
